Assassin’s Creed set in feudal Japan coming after 2023

Ubisoft has laid down a roadmap for the future of Assassin’s Creed, featuring two major new games coming beyond 2023’s Baghdad-set Mirage.

Set in feudal Japan, Assassin’s Creed: Project Red will arrive at some point after 2023. It’s described as an open-world RPG, a chance for fans to live out their powerful shinobi fantasy, and is in development by the talented Quebec-based team behind Assassin’s Creed Odyssey.

Sometime after that, Assassin’s Creed: Project Hexe will be next to launch. Details are extremely thin, but it looks to be a mysterious, witchcraft-inspired entry, and is being worked on by the Valhalla team at Ubisoft Montreal.
